IR absorption spectra of double Waterless potassium and rare earth sulfates of KTR(SO4)2 composition
Description
Infrared IR absorption spectra of binary sulfates of KTR(SO4)2 (TR - Pr, Nd, Sm, Tb, Dy, Er, Tm, Yb) have been studied. The frequencies have been ascribed to the vibration of the anionic and cationic sublattice of the crystal. The results of group theoretical analysis corroborate the X-ray analysis data indicative of the presence of five structural types as far as compounds KTR(SO4)2 are concerned
